#143b76 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#143b76 is composed of 7.8% red, 23.1% green and 46.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.1% cyan, 50% magenta, 0% yellow and 53.7% black. It has a hue angle of 216.1 degrees, a saturation of 71% and a lightness of 27.1%. #143b76 color hex could be obtained by blending #2876ec with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003366.

#143b76 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#143b76 has RGB values of R:20, G:59, B:118 and CMYK values of C:0.83, M:0.5, Y:0, K:0.54. Its decimal value is 1325942.
